auto_awesomeAnalysis
AGNC Investment Corp. delivered robust financial results for the fourth quarter and full year 2025, significantly boosting its tangible net book value and economic return. The company reported a substantial 7.2% increase in tangible net book value per common share quarter-over-quarter, reaching $8.88, alongside an impressive 11.6% economic return on tangible common equity for the quarter. For the full year, the economic return was 22.7%, contributing to a 34.8% total stock return. These strong performance metrics, coupled with a successful capital raise of $356 million through At-the-Market offerings at a premium to book value, underscore the company's effective portfolio management and favorable market conditions. Management expressed an optimistic outlook for 2026, citing constructive investment backdrops and potential catalysts for further mortgage spread tightening, which could continue to drive favorable risk-adjusted returns.
At the time of this filing, AGNC was trading at $11.81 on NASDAQ in the Real Estate & Construction sector, with a market capitalization of approximately $12.7B.
